Levofloxacin Lactate Injection
Main ingredients and chemical name of this product: The main ingredient of this product is levofloxacin lactate, and its chemical name is: (S)-(-)-9-fluoro-2-,3-dihydro-3-methyl-10(4-methyl-1-piperazinyl)-7-oxo-7H-pyrido[1,2,3-de][1,4]-benzoxazine-6-carboxylic acid lactate hemihydrate. [Molecular formula] C18H20FN3O4C3H6O31/2H2O [Molecular weight] 460.41
Name Description Content CAS NO. Registered Holders
LEVOFLOXACIN LACTATE

This product is the levorotatory form of ofloxacin, and its antibacterial activity is about 2 times that of ofloxacin. Its main mechanism of action is to inhibit bacterial DNA gyrase activity and inhibit bacterial DNA replication. It has the characteristics of broad antibacterial spectrum and strong antibacterial effect. It has strong antibacterial activity against most Enterobacteriaceae, such as Klebsiella pneumoniae, Proteus, Salmonella typhi, Shigella, influenza bacillus, some Escherichia coli, Pseudomonas aeruginosa, and gonococci; it also has good antibacterial effect against some Staphylococci, Streptococcus pneumoniae, Chlamydia, etc.

Levofloxacin Lactate Tablets
Levofloxacin lactate.
Name Description Content CAS NO. Registered Holders
Levofloxacin lactate

This product has a broad-spectrum antibacterial effect and strong antibacterial effect. It has strong antibacterial activity against most Enterobacteriaceae, such as Escherichia coli, Klebsiella, Proteus, Salmonella, Shigella, and Gram-negative bacteria such as Haemophilus influenzae, Legionella pneumophila, and Neisseria gonorrhoeae. It also has antibacterial effects on Gram-positive bacteria such as Staphylococcus aureus, Streptococcus pneumoniae, Streptococcus pyogenes, and Mycoplasma pneumoniae and Chlamydia pneumoniae, but has poor effects on anaerobic bacteria and enterococci. This product is the levorotatory form of ofloxacin, and its in vitro antibacterial activity is about twice that of ofloxacin. Its mechanism of action is to inhibit the activity of bacterial DNA gyrase, prevent the synthesis and replication of bacterial DNA, and cause bacterial death.

Yanhuning
The main ingredient of this product is indomethacin, and its chemical name is 14-dehydroxy-11,12-didehydroandrographolide-3,19-disuccinic acid hemiester potassium sodium salt-hydrate.
Name Description Content CAS NO. Registered Holders
PotassiuM sodiuM Dehydroandrographolide Succinate

It has an antipyretic effect on rabbits with fever caused by bacterial endotoxins; it can counteract the increased permeability of capillary walls caused by xylene or histamine; it has a significant sedative effect; it promotes the function of the adrenal cortex of rats and enhances the body's emergency response to pathogen infection; it has a certain inactivation effect on influenza virus type A1, type A3, pneumonia adenovirus (Adv) type III, type IV, enterosyncytial virus and respiratory syncytial virus (RSV) in vitro.
